Description

ZeroAvia is leading the transition to zero-emission aviation through the development of hydrogen-electric propulsion systems for civil and defence aerospace applications. As the world's only Design Organization Approved business focused exclusively on hydrogen-electric aviation, we have achieved significant flight test and regulatory milestones with the UK CAA and FAA and secured more than 3,000 pre-orders from airlines, OEMs and defence customers globally. As ZeroAvia advances towards certification and commercial deployment, the Senior Mechanical Design Engineer will play a key role in the design, development and delivery of critical mechanical systems and structures for our hydrogen-electric propulsion programmes. Combining technical leadership with hands-on design expertise, you will drive the creation of complex, certifiable and manufacturable engineering solutions while collaborating closely with manufacturing, test, certification and cross-functional engineering teams. You will also support technical reviews, mentor engineers and help establish engineering best practice as we scale our technology towards commercial operation. Requirements

Responsibilities

  • Create, develop, and maintain complex 3D CAD models, manufacturing drawings, engineering documentation, and associated design data for mechanical components and assemblies.
  • Apply sound mechanical engineering principles, including GD&T, material selection, manufacturing processes, and supporting analysis, to deliver robust, manufacturable, and compliant design solutions.
  • Manage design data and configuration within the PLM system, ensuring all engineering outputs meet applicable quality, certification, and regulatory requirements.
  • Collaborate with engineering, manufacturing, and external stakeholders to resolve technical challenges, support production activities, and ensure successful project delivery.
  • Lead design reviews and technical sign-off activities, providing technical leadership, mentoring junior engineers, reviewing engineering deliverables, and holding or working towards engineering signatory approval authority.

 

Key Requirements:

  • Degree in Mechanical Engineering or equivalent industry experience
  • Minimum of 7 years' experience in mechanical design, preferably within the aerospace or other highly regulated industries.
  • Advanced proficiency in 3D CAD, with Siemens NX preferred, including the creation of complex components, assemblies, and engineering drawings with a strong working knowledge of GD&T.
  • Excellent knowledge of engineering materials, manufacturing processes, and configuration management within a Teamcenter PLM environment.
  • Demonstrated ability to lead technical activities, draft, review and approve engineering documentation, mentor junior engineers.

Desirable Skills:

  • Experience supporting aerospace certification programmes and compliance with relevant regulatory requirements.
  • Knowledge of hydrogen, fuel cell, or propulsion system technologies.
  • Experience of composite design and manufacturing methods.
